Newtown Friday Night
Small Report from last night in Newtown. I left when it was heads up between ritchie and greg. both seemed to have equal chips. On the final table i pushed with 66, was called by 44 and a,k and greg hit a set of 4s on the flop. Earlier in the night I made the biggest fold prelop, as I raised preflop with KINGS, Dominic pushed all in and was instacalled by ritchie so I knew one of them had ACES and I was right as Dom had JACKS and Ritchie the Aces. Low and behold first card on the flop a King!!! great fold preflop but in the end I would have been monster Chip leader and Ricthie would have been gone. I did make a hero call when Beaudine pushed all in for 11k, when i had hit top pair, top kicker on a 10,9, 5 rianbow board, ace on the turn and another 5 on the river. Unlucky BO!!
Good nights game with prizes for 1st to 4th 300, 200, 100, 50.

Star Poker Bray report from Thursday
Carlo Popplewell and Paul Hempenstall split the Thursday €30 Scalp Tournament. They beat a field of 22 players with top spot paying €220. Between them they also cashed in for an extra €55 in scalps. The Poker Jackpot will roll-over to next week.

Star Poker Bray Report from Wednesday
Congratulations to Patrick Wolohan who beat a field of 69 players to win the Wednesday €20 Freeze-Out Tournament. When he called an all-in shove pre flop with A4 against K3 he was already ahead but an ace on the turn made sure of his success. Patrick won €383 with the top 7 getting paid. Poker Jackpot will Roll over to next week.
